Women Rock: Pops Concert

TFO honors the powerful women who changed rock ‘n’ roll forever. Featuring three of Broadway’s brightest young female stars for the iconic music of Tina Turner, Heart, Aretha Franklin, Carole King, Janis Joplin and many more. Chelsea Gallo conducts.

For a printable version of the repertoire, click here.

Piece of My Heart
By Jerry Ragovoy and Bert Russell
As recorded by Janis Joplin

Dancing in the Street
By Marvin Gaye, Ivy George Hunter and William Stevenson
As recorded by Martha Reeves

So Far Away
By Carole King
As recorded by Carole King

Flashdance . . . What a Feeling
By Irene Cara and Giorgio Moroder
As recorded by Irene Cara

Freeway of Love
By Jeffrey Cohen and Narada Michael Walden
As recorded by Aretha Franklin

Up on the Roof
By Carole King and Gerald Goffin
As recorded by Carole King

Love is a Battlefield
By Holly Knight and Michael Chapman
As recorded by Pat Benatar

You Make Me Feel Like a Natural Woman
By Carole King, Gerald Goffin and Gerald Wexler
As recorded by Carole King

– Intermission –

Pick up the Pieces
By the Average White Band
As recorded by the Average White Band

I Love Rock n’ Roll
By Jane Hooker Richards and Allan Sachs
As recorded by Joan Jett

These Dreams
By Martin Page and Bernard Taupin
As recorded by Heart

Best (Simply the Best)
By Holly Knight and Michael Chapman
As recorded by Tina Turner

I Feel the Earth Move
By Carole King
As recorded by Carole King

You’ve got a Friend
By Carole King
As recorded by Carole King

Hit Me with Your Best Shot
By Edward Schwartz
As recorded by Pat Benatar

What’s Love Got To Do With It
By Terence Ernest Britten and Graham Hamilton Lyle
As recorded by Tina Turner

Proud Mary
By John Cameron Fogerty
As recorded by Tina Turner

All arrangements licensed By Schirmer Theatrical, LLC
